Neuphoria Therapeutics Inc. (NEUP) reported a Q1 2026 GAAP EPS of -$0.09, significantly outperforming the consensus estimate of -$0.9894 by a 90.9% surprise. The company reported no revenue, consistent with its pre-commercial stage. Despite the loss, shares surged 7.03% in the trading session following the announcement.

Neuphoria’s Q1 2026 results reflect a dramatic improvement in operating efficiency. The net loss of approximately $0.09 per share compared favorably to the prior-year period, driven by disciplined cost management and reduced R&D expenses related to its lead neuroscience programs. The company continues to advance its pipeline of novel therapies targeting neurological disorders, with no approved products or commercial revenues yet recorded. Research and development spending remained focused on Phase 2 trials, while general and administrative costs were trimmed. The lower-than-expected loss suggests management may have achieved operational leverage as it progresses toward key clinical milestones. Notably, no segment or geographic revenue lines are applicable given the absence of marketed products. The improved bottom line contributed to a positive stock reaction, as investors viewed the tighter financial performance as a sign of prudent stewardship. Management did not provide explicit forward guidance for the next quarter, consistent with typical practice for development-stage biotechs. However, the company reiterated its strategic priority to advance its lead asset, a novel neuromodulator candidate, through clinical proof-of-concept. Neuphoria anticipates initiating a Phase 2b study in the second half of fiscal 2026, pending regulatory feedback. The company’s cash runway, supported by recent financing activities, may extend into early 2027, though ongoing clinical trials could accelerate spending. Key risk factors include trial enrollment delays, regulatory hurdles, and the need for additional capital to fund development. Investors should note that while the EPS surprise was substantial, it largely reflects a lower cost base rather than revenue generation, and future quarters may see wider losses as clinical activity ramps up. The stock rose 7.03% on the earnings day, suggesting that the unexpectedly narrow loss was well received by the market. Analysts may update their models to reflect the lower operating burn rate, but caution remains warranted given the pre-revenue stage. The significant EPS beat (90.9% above estimates) could attract speculative buying interest, but the lack of revenue and ongoing clinical risk temper long-term conviction. Key catalysts to watch include patient enrollment updates for the upcoming Phase 2b trial and potential partnership or licensing deals that could provide non-dilutive funding. The company’s cash position and burn rate will be critical to monitor in subsequent quarters. Overall, NEUP’s Q1 2026 results provide a moment of relative stability, but the path to commercialization remains uncertain.
